centos6.4にnginx1.12.1をインストールする方法

WBOY
リリース: 2023-05-13 19:10:10
転載
1004 人が閲覧しました

インストールに必要な環境

1. gcc のインストール

nginx をインストールするには、以下からダウンロードしたソースコードをコンパイルする必要があります。コンパイルは gcc 環境に依存します gcc 環境がない場合は、

yum install gcc-c++
ログイン後にコピー

2 をインストールする必要があります。pcre pcre-devel インストール

pcre(perl 互換正規表現) Perl 互換の正規表現ライブラリを含む Perl ライブラリです。 nginx の http モジュールは正規表現の解析に pcre を使用するため、Linux には pcre ライブラリをインストールする必要があります。pcre-devel は、pcre を使用して開発された二次開発ライブラリです。 nginx にもこのライブラリが必要です。コマンド:

yum install -y pcre pcre-devel
ログイン後にコピー

3. zlib のインストール

zlib ライブラリには多くの圧縮および解凍方法が用意されており、nginx は zlib を使用して http パッケージのコンテンツを gzip 圧縮します。 , そのため、zlib ライブラリを centos にインストールする必要があります。

yum install -y zlib zlib-devel
ログイン後にコピー

4. openssl のインストール

openssl は、主要な暗号化アルゴリズム、一般的に使用されるキー、および証明書が管理機能をカプセル化した、強力なセキュア ソケット レイヤ暗号化ライブラリです。および SSL プロトコルをサポートしており、テストやその他の目的のための豊富なアプリケーション セットを提供します。

nginx は http プロトコルをサポートするだけでなく、https (つまり、SSL プロトコルを介して http を送信する) もサポートするため、openssl ライブラリを centos にインストールする必要があります。

yum install -y openssl openssl-devel
ログイン後にコピー

インストール

1.nginx URL

2.wget コマンドを使用してダウンロード

#wget -c https://nginx.org/download/nginx-1.12.1.tar.gz
ログイン後にコピー

centos6.4にnginx1.12.1をインストールする方法

3.解凍

#tar -zxvf nginx-1.12.1.tar.gz
#cd nginx-1.12.1
ログイン後にコピー

centos6.4にnginx1.12.1をインストールする方法

4.構成

#./configure
ログイン後にコピー

centos6.4にnginx1.12.1をインストールする方法

5. インストール

#make
ログイン後にコピー

centos6.4にnginx1.12.1をインストールする方法

#make install
ログイン後にコピー

インストール パスを見つけます:

#whereis nginx
ログイン後にコピー

Start and stop nginx

#cd /usr/local/nginx/sbin/
./nginx 
./nginx -s stop
./nginx -s quit
./nginx -s reload
ログイン後にコピー

./nginx -s quit: このメソッドの停止ステップは、タスクの完了後に nginx プロセスを停止することです。
./nginx -s stop: この方法は、最初に nginx プロセス ID を見つけてから、kill コマンドを使用してプロセスを強制的に終了するのと同じです。

nginx プロセスをクエリします:

#ps aux|grep nginx
ログイン後にコピー

nginx を起動し、ブラウザに「localhost」と入力します

centos6.4にnginx1.12.1をインストールする方法

以上がcentos6.4にnginx1.12.1をインストールする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:yisu.com
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ート